Abstract

ABSTRACTThis study discusses to discuss and analyze Comparison of Islamic Bank Financial Performance in Indonesia Using Comparison of Income Statement (ISA) and Volume Added Reporting (VAR). Population and sample are Islamic Commercial Banks registered with Bank Indonesia for the period 2014-2018. The data analysis this study used SPSS version 20. The sampling technique used in this study was purposive sampling method and the data testing technique used in this study was normality test, descriptive statistical test and research hypothesis testing. The results of this study indicate a significant difference in Islamic finance when viewed from the ROA ratio with the approval of ISA and VAR.
